The Fascinating World of Sea Shells: A Journey Through Nature’s Treasures
Sea shells are some of nature’s most beautiful and intricate creations. They are the hard, protective outer covering of marine animals, specifically mollusks, and have been cherished by humans for centuries for their natural beauty and historical significance. What Are Sea Shells?
Sea shells are primarily made of calcium carbonate and are produced by marine mollusks like snails, clams, oysters, and limpets. As these creatures grow, they secrete the material that forms their shells. Over time, the shells develop unique shapes, sizes, colors, and textures, each one a work of art sculpted by nature. Sea shells provide protection for the delicate animals inside, and once the mollusk dies or is removed, the shell often washes up on beaches, where it can be found and collected.
Types of Sea Shells
There are countless varieties of sea shells, each with distinct features:
Univalve Shells: These shells, like those of snails, consist of a single, spiral-shaped piece. Common examples include conchs and cowrie shells.
Bivalve Shells: These shells come in pairs and are hinged together. Clams, oysters, and mussels are classic examples of bivalves.
Gastropods: The largest class of mollusks, gastropods include snails, which often have beautifully spiraled shells.
Cowries: Recognized by their smooth, glossy surfaces and colorful patterns, cowrie shells have long been prized by collectors and used as currency in some cultures.
Conchs and Nautilus: Known for their iconic spiral shapes and large size, conch shells have been historically important for both their beauty and their use in tools and musical instruments.
The Importance of Sea Shells
Sea shells have had significant cultural, artistic, and even scientific importance throughout history:
Cultural Significance: Shells have been used as jewelry, currency, and symbols in various cultures worldwide. For example, in ancient times, cowrie shells were used as currency in Africa and Asia. Some cultures also use shells in rituals and spiritual practices.
Natural Beauty and Artistry: With their incredible variety of colors, patterns, and textures, sea shells are often used in decorative arts and crafts. Their intricate patterns inspire artists, jewelers, and designers alike.
Ecological Role: Sea shells play a crucial role in the marine ecosystem. They serve as habitats for small creatures, protect mollusks, and, after being discarded, often provide homes for new marine life.
Collecting Sea Shells
Sea shell collecting is a popular hobby for many beachgoers and nature enthusiasts. Here are some tips to help you start your own collection:
Know the Regulations: Always check local laws and regulations before collecting shells, as some areas prohibit the removal of certain species, especially those that are endangered or protected.
Look for Unique Specimens: Pay attention to the size, color, and condition of the shells. The rarest and most valuable shells are often those in perfect condition or with distinctive patterns.
Preservation: Clean your shells gently using warm water and a soft brush. Avoid using harsh chemicals that may damage their natural surfaces.
Display and Storage: To showcase your collection, consider using shadow boxes or glass containers. Ensure that your shells are kept dry and safe from direct sunlight to preserve their colors and integrity.
